M4A

M4A is a common audio container extension often used for AAC or ALAC audio, especially in Apple-related ecosystems. It is best for music distribution, mobile listening, and modern audio libraries that do not need the legacy expectations of MP3.

MIME Type:

audio/mp4

Common Uses:

Music libraries and downloads, Mobile audio playback, Modern compressed or lossless audio packaging

Advantages:

  • Common in modern consumer audio workflows
  • Can carry efficient AAC or lossless ALAC audio
  • Works well in mobile and Apple-oriented environments

Disadvantages:

  • Compatibility may be slightly less universal than MP3 in older devices
  • The extension alone does not always make the underlying codec obvious

AIF

AIF is an alternate file extension for AIFF audio and is used for the same high-quality audio workflows. It is best for uncompressed audio exchange, editing, and archival tasks where compatibility with AIFF-based tools matters.

MIME Type:

audio/aiff

Common Uses:

Uncompressed audio editing, AIFF-compatible exchange, High-quality archival storage

Advantages:

  • Provides full uncompressed audio quality
  • Useful in editing and production contexts
  • Compatible with AIFF-oriented audio workflows

Disadvantages:

  • Large files make storage and transfer less efficient
  • Not convenient for casual streaming or lightweight distribution
